Microsoft Copilot Studio - strengths & limits

Strengths

  • Inherits Microsoft 365 data, permissions and identity
  • Low-code building blocks suit non-developer makers
  • Publishes into Teams where internal users already work

Watch out for

  • Cost is layered on top of Microsoft licensing
  • Message-based pricing needs monitoring in busy deployments
  • Outside the Microsoft ecosystem its advantages shrink quickly

Zapier - strengths & limits

Strengths

  • Widest app coverage of any mainstream automation platform
  • Non-engineers can build genuinely useful workflows
  • Debugging and history make failures traceable

Watch out for

  • Task-based pricing gets expensive at high volume
  • Complex workflows become hard to maintain without discipline
  • Not suited to low-latency or high-computation processing
